Cloud Security Engineer
Description
Leidos' Corporate Information Security within the Digital Modernization Sector has an immediate opening for a Cloud Security Engineer to join our Cloud Security Engineering and Operations team.
In this role, you will provide security engineering services for the enterprise cloud management team for major cloud providers such as AWS, Azure, and especially M365.
We're looking for a candidate who can support this role from one of our following locations: Orlando - FL, Reston - VA, Gaithersburg - MD, or Remote Telework.
About the Team
Typical activities of this team include writing concept of operations (CONOPS), detailed design and deployment documentation for new capabilities and services, implementation of solutions, and supporting the on-going operations of cloud security solutions.

Typical workflows range from individual tasks, leading small-scale projects, and participating in multi-disciplinary, multi-team projects to help Leidos meet its technology and security goals.
Primary Responsibilities:
- Work on a team of motivated security engineers in designing, building and deploying security capabilities for protecting Leidos cloud-based systems, networks, and information stores.
- Act as Subject Matter Expert for cloud security services to defend the global Leidos environments.
- Provide expertise regarding cloud providers' capabilities, APIs, and shared security models.
- Work closely with engineering team members across infrastructure teams and outside vendors to ensure that features and capabilities are delivered on-schedule and operated according to corporate service level agreements.
- Work closely with the cloud management and platform security teams to improve existing solutions so they better meet the business' needs.
- Work closely with the Cybersecurity Intelligence and Response Center to ensure the cloud security solutions are meeting the requirements for security event investigations
- Help develop cloud security technical roadmaps to drive constant cyber transformation and improvements in Leidos' defensive posture
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or's Degree and 2-4 years of relevant experience, including 2 years of experience in an enterprise security or infrastructure engineering role. Additional years of relevant experience, training, and/or professional certifications may be considered in lieu of Bachelor's degree.
- US citizenship is required as well as eligibility for federal security clearance
- Demonstrated experience deploying/operating cloud security enterprise technologies
- Experience with Microsoft M365 security controls and Entra.
- Demonstrated experience with the capabilities and APIs of one major cloud provider (AWS, Azure, or Google).
- Fundamental knowledge of TCP/IP and common application layer protocols
- Foundational understanding of Cloud and off-premises security best practices
- Experience with industry standard virtualized networking components (Cloud application firewalls, Cloud Services Routers, Cloud Gateways, etc.)
- Strong communication skills; person in this role must be able to successfully communicate with management personnel, technical personnel and third parties
Preferred Qualifications:
Special consideration will be given to candidates with any, or multiple, of the following qualifications:
- Demonstrated experience with the capabilities and APIs of multiple major cloud providers (AWS, Azure, Google).
- Experience within common enterprise cloud applications SaaS (O365, etc.)
- Experience deploying or maintaining cloud access security broker (CASB) solutions.
- Experience with application registrations and enterprise application management within Entra
- Experience designing and provisioning security architectures at enterprise scale
- Experience authoring enterprise cloud security policies, or establishing an enterprise cloud security strategy
- Experience implementing multi-factor authentication for SaaS applications
- Experience obtaining and centralizing cloud audit data and associated capabilities
- Experience in programming and/or scripting desired
- Knowledge of configuration management tools such as Terraform, Ansible, Puppet, or Chef
- Knowledge of Microsoft Active Directory desired
- Experience with cloud IaaS solutions such as Microsoft Azure or Amazon AWS
- Possess certifications from major cloud providers, such as Azure or AWS Security Engineer
- Possess CISSP or other major industry certifications
